Motonari Tonegawa is an academic researcher from University of Tokyo. The author has contributed to research in topics: Redshift & Galaxy. The author has an hindex of 11, co-authored 22 publications receiving 583 citations. Previous affiliations of Motonari Tonegawa include Kyoto University & Korea Institute for Advanced Study.
